In high-voltage electrical rooms, small busbars are usually connected to the main high-voltage bus or directly to the secondary side of a transformer. The main bus distributes power to various feeders, and the small busbar acts as a localized distribution point for specific equipment or subcircuits . The connection is often made via cables or bus ducts that are bolted or clamped to ensure low-resistance contact and mechanical stability .
